Anyone who likes the original should try this remake~! It adds a fresh coat of paint to all the visuals, and a couple shortcuts have been added in some chapters to mitigate some of the backtracking! The new remake soundtrack is good, even adding alternate versions of some songs (like separate songs for Hooktail, Gloomtail, and Bonetail!), although also different from the original, which was a masterpiece in its own right. But, for those who would rather listen to the original soundtrack, the Nostalgic Tunes badge (available for a paltry 1 coin in Rogueport’s Badge Shop) can set the soundtrack back to the original~! ➕Enhanced Graphics: Improved visuals and animations, especially in locations like Twilight Town. ➕Updated Soundtrack: Access to the original GameCube soundtrack from the Badge shop. ➕Quality-of-Life Improvements: Quick-travel feature and improved hint system, and many more. ➕Consistent Performance: Holds a consistent 30fps in both docked and undocked modes. ➖Lower Frame Rate: Frame rate is 30fps, down from the original 60fps. ➖Script Changes: Some controversial elements have been removed, altering the original dialogue. ➖Pacing: Some chapters feel like they drag, such as Chapter 5 with the back and forth platforming and the Don Piñata fetch quests. ➖ Difficulty: Some returning players might find the game easier than the original due to the quality-of-life changes made in the remake. In Summary: Paper Mario: The Thousand-Year Door on the Nintendo Switch revitalizes a classic game with modern enhancements. Despite the contention with the script changes and some pacing issues, its charming visuals, engaging story, and strategic gameplay make it a standout title in the Mario RPG series, appealing to both nostalgic fans and new players. HowLongToBeat Time: 30.5 hours | My Clear Time: 33 hours 59 mins.

This remake manages to go above and beyond the expectations of Paper Mario fans and Nintendo fans alike and delivers on nearly every front. Brand new music, stunning new visuals with a perfected Paper aesthetic, expressive animations, 360 degree hammering, the ability to switch to gamecube tracks on the fly, it's got it all. There's even 2 new Superbosses that weren't in the original game. And if you had any doubts, you can rest assured that this remake is faithful down to every last detail of the gamecube release from 2004. It manages to improve what was already a masterpiece of a game and push it to near perfection. The best part of TTYD is the stellar badge system which allows for near endless gameplay customization, letting players choose the difficulty themselves. Badges like double pain, unsimplifier, and the ability to only upgrade BP and nothing else makes for a fun and difficult optional extra challenge for skilled players willing to go the extra mile. The only downsides are that some animations especially in battles take a bit too long. Starpower animations, the time it takes to restore HP, FP, and SP after leveling up, and cutscenes are not skippable from the get-go. This could easily be fixed however in a future update, and even these things can be overlooked, since as a whole this game is a magnificent masterclass of an RPG, maintaining all of the nuances and battle mechanics that were in the 1st 2 Paper Mario games.
